Requirements for Connection Technologies
IIn aviation, the requirements for connection technologies—such as cable assemblies, electromechanical components, and systems—are particularly demanding. These technologies are crucial for the operation of measurement instruments, control and navigation systems, and communication systems. The quality and reliability of these components are essential to ensuring safety and efficiency in air transport.
